> > +	offloads = DEV_RX_OFFLOAD_HEADER_SPLIT;
> 
> As I can see I ixgbe all header_split code is enabled only if
> RTE_HEADER_SPLIT_ENABLE is on.
> It is off by default and I doubt anyone really using it these days.
> So I think the best thing would be not to advertise
> DEV_RX_OFFLOAD_HEADER_SPLIT for ixgbe at all, and probably remove
> related code.
> If you'd prefer to keep it, then at least we should set that capability only at
> #ifdef RTE_HEADER_SPLIT_ENABLE.
> Another thing - 	it should be per port, not per queue.
> Thought I think better is just to remove it completely.
I will set this header splitting capability in #ifdef RTE_HEADER_SPLIT_ENABLE in my next patch set.
I think it is a per queue capability as it can be configured on the register IXGBE_SRRCTL of every Rx queue
In this code line: IXGBE_WRITE_REG(hw, IXGBE_SRRCTL(rxq->reg_idx), srrctl); in ixgbe_dev_rx_init( ).
Same case is also in the code line: IXGBE_WRITE_REG(hw, IXGBE_VFSRRCTL(i), srrctl); in ixgbevf_dev_rx_init( ).

> > +	if ((requested & (queue_supported | port_supported)) != requested)
> > +		return 0;
> > +
> > +	if ((port_offloads ^ requested) & port_supported)
> 
> Could you explain a bit more what are you cheking here?
> As I can see:
>  (port_offloads ^ requested) - that's a diff between already set and newly
> requested offloads.
> Then you check if that diff consists of supported by port offloads, and if yes
> you return an error?
> Konstantin
> 
This function is similar to mlx4_check_rx_queue_offloads() in mlx4 driver.
As the git log message in the commit ce17eddefc20285bbfe575bdc07f42f0b20f34cb say
that a per port capability should has same setting (enabling or disabling) on both port
configuration via rte_eth_dev_configure( ) and queue configuration via rte_eth_rx_queue_setup( ).
This function check if this requirement is matched or not.
It also check offloading request is supported as a per port or a per queue capability or not.
If above checking is pass, it return 1 else return 0.
